14.6 Firmware

The ADI-6432's main part has been realized using programmable logic. By re-programming of a
little component called Flash-PROM, both function and behaviour of the unit can be changed at
any time.
At the time of writing this manual, the unit is shipped with firmware 1.5. The firmware version is
displayed after power on for about one second by the SYNC and AUDIO LEDs of the AES
INPUT STATE section.

14.8 MADI User Bit Chart

• RS-232: channels 1 to 9
• ADC: channel 19
• MIDI: channel 56 (48k) / 28 (96k)
